COCP 2212 Android Development I
This course is an introduction to programming Android devices such as smartphones and tablets. Students will learn the Android development environment and will create simple applications. Flexible user interfaces appropriate for various devices will be developed using XML layouts. The activity life cycle, fragments, and use of intents will be explored. Data driven applications using files, XML and SQLite will be developed. The social and ethical issues of creating and deploying mobile applications and devices are discussed.
